Student-Led Conferences
This year conferences will be student-led and conducted virtually through your child's advisory class via Google Meets. Conferences are scheduled for 20 minutes. It's important that your child is with you during the conference as they will be reviewing their progress and final grades for each class.
Parents should receive a letter from their advisory teacher by November 8 to sign up for a conference time.
Please contact your student's advisory teacher or the Main Office at (503) 663-3323, if you need assistance in scheduling a conference day and/or time.

Covid Notification Letters
If there is a positive case of Covid in our school, you will receive a notification letter sent via School Messenger indicating that there has been a confirmed positive Covid case in our school. This is just a notification. There is no further action needed on your part.
If your child was exposed or in close contact with someone with Covid while at school, your child may need to quarantine. Close contact is described as closer than 6 feet without a mask for 15 minutes or longer. If that is the case, you will receive a phone call and a separate letter with quarantine details and timelines.
As always, please feel free to contact the school office if you have any questions. 503-663-3323.
